Hello,

 

I foolishly bought a large car yesterday from Carcraft, so today I went back to do the 7 day exchange, however they have told me they have to wait for Black Horse finance to return the money (or something along those lines)

and that it could take 2 or 3 days.

 

Now, it's the bank holiday weekend and this puts it at potentially Tuesday or Wednesday next week, i.e. right at the end of my exchange window.

 

I'm wondering whether this "2 or 3 days" to get the finance resorted with Black Horse is normal or whether they are trying to screw me around so that I can't swap cars.

 

The car I have seen to exchange it for is cheaper, and I've told them I will pay the cash to get it instead of taking out another finance policy.

 

They have told me until Black Horse gets sorted, they can't take the car I bought yesterday back nor give me the new one.

 

Is this normal?

 

I messed them around a little bit which I've apologized for but I'm uneasy at whether they are trying to con me out of the exchange in some sort of revenge.

 

I have rung them several times and been assured it's all fine, etc. but obviously they would say that, any third-party advice or the Carcraft Customer Service people that can kind of advise on this would be much appreciated.

 

I also offered to pay a deposit on the new car (it's currently being used as a company car by someone in their showroom), which they said I didn't need to pay.

Update nearly a month on: Carcraft never completed the return of advance so Black Horse just took near £400 out of my account, completely unexpected because the finance manager at Leeds told me to not worry and it'd be completed 3 days after I had left.

 

Not sure I'm going to trust these people again now, such a joke from people that claim to be professionals.

Black Horse had said a full return of advance came through to them a few days ago, so it's questionable as to why it took Carcraft so long to get it done, and it looks like the Direct Debit was in motion by that point but if it had been returned to Black Horse within a week of the car being exchanged, this wouldn't of been a problem. I guess it's in Black Horses' hands now to close the account and issue a refund, just annoyed this has happened in the first place.

I got the money back yesterday after going into my local bank branch and requesting an indemnity claim be raised against Black Horse, the V5 has been put in the post today and it should be with you, hopefully by the end of this week - I have not included a letter or anything with it, it's just the V5 in an envelope.
